Interior designers use creativity and critical thinking to turn concepts into reality, wowing clients with stunning homes, workspaces or businesses. They also communicate clearly with clients, prepare construction documents, consider specifications and work within a budget. Gateway’s Interior Design associate degree equips you with the skills and the professional experience needed to prepare you for an exciting career as an interior designer.

  • Learn hands-on in the Creative Resource Center and computer labs fully stocked with design supplies and industry software. Put your skills to the test by designing and installing an entire room at Gateway’s Center for Sustainable Living after completing your first two semesters in the program.
  • Build your professional portfolio by joining the American Society of Interior Designers and completing internships that provide real-world experience.
  • Earn certificates to focus on elements of interior design that align with your career goals, including Sustainable Design, Technology for Interior Design and more.
  • Explore career options like furniture design, showroom consulting, commercial design, CAD drafting, sales and home staging.
  • Earn great wages in a high-demand field while putting your skills to use and improving your clients’ lives through your impressive room designs.
Program Credits

65

Location

Kenosha Campus

Financial Aid Eligible

Yes

Estimated Program Cost

Tuition & Fees: $10,563
Books & Supplies: $4,819

Start Dates

Fall

Salary Outlook

$53,851

Career Opportunities: Residential Designer, Kitchen and Bath Designer, Corporate Designer, Sales Representative, Home Stager
